用于创建机器学习系统的方法和设备与流程

文档序号:28533184发布日期:2022-01-19 13:33阅读:来源:国知局

技术特征:
1.一种用于创建机器学习系统的计算机实现的方法,所述方法包括以下步骤:提供具有输入节点和输出节点的有向图(11),所述输入节点和输出节点经由多个边(100)和节点连接,其中给每个边分别分配概率,所述概率表征以何种概率抽取相应的边,其中所述概率最初被设置为一个值,使得从相应的边出发直至输出节点的路径以相同的概率被抽取;随机地抽取通过所述图的多个路径并且对与路径相对应的机器学习系统进行训练,以及其中在训练时,对所述机器学习系统的参数和所述路径的边的概率进行适配,使得优化成本函数;和根据经适配的概率来抽取路径并且创建与该路径相对应的机器学习系统。2.根据权利要求1所述的方法,其特征在于,从所选择的节点出发,对直至输出节点的所有可能的路径进行计数,其中从所选择的节点出发连接的那些边的概率的值分别最初被设置为经由那些边伸展的可能路径的数量除以所计数的可能路径的数量。3.根据权利要求1或2的方法,其中对于所述有向图(11)的每个节点,对直至输出节点的所有可能路径进行计数,其中所述边的概率的值最初被设置为相应边的输出节点的可能路径的数量除以所述边的输入节点的可能路径的数量。4.根据前述权利要求中任一项所述的方法,其中在抽取所述路径时,迭代地创建所述路径,其中在每个节点处随机地从与该节点连接的可能后续边中根据其所分配的概率选择所述后续边。5.一种计算机程序,所述计算机程序包括指令,所述指令被设立用于当所述指令在计算机上被执行时促使所述计算机执行根据前述权利要求中任一项所述的方法。6.一种机器可读存储元件,其上存放有根据权利要求5所述的计算机程序。7.一种设备,所述设备被设立用于执行根据权利要求1至4中任一项所述的方法。

技术总结
用于创建机器学习系统的方法和设备。本发明涉及一种用于创建机器学习系统的方法,所述方法包括以下步骤:提供具有输入节点和输出节点的有向图,其中给每个边分别分配概率,所述概率表征以何种概率抽取边。概率最初被设置为一个值,使得从相应边出发直至输出节点的路径以相同的概率被抽取。以相同的概率被抽取。以相同的概率被抽取。


技术研发人员:B
受保护的技术使用者:罗伯特
技术研发日:2021.07.14
技术公布日:2022/1/18
当前第2页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1